Drawing inspiration from the words of Nelson Mandela, who famously stated that education is the most powerful weapon we can use to change the world, it&#8217;s essential to explore how this philosophy can reshape the financial advisory landscape. By prioritizing education, financial advisers can empower their clients, enabling them to make informed choices that pave the way for a secure and prosperous future.<\/p>\n<p>At its core, financial planning is about more than just numbers and investment strategies; it is about empowering clients with knowledge. When clients understand their financial landscape, they are better prepared to navigate uncertainties and challenges. This understanding fosters agency, enabling individuals to take control of their financial destinies. As financial advisers, our responsibility goes beyond providing solutions; it involves educating clients about their options and instilling the confidence needed to make crucial decisions.<\/p>\n<p>The financial world is increasingly complex. With evolving regulations, fluctuating markets, and a constant barrage of information, clients often find themselves overwhelmed. Questions like, \u201cCan I afford to buy a home?\u201d or \u201cAm I saving enough for retirement?\u201d are common and can lead to anxiety. This is where the value of a financial adviser becomes apparent. By acting as educators, advisers can help clients sift through the noise and make sense of their financial situations.<\/p>\n<p>One of the most significant contributions a financial adviser can make is to help clients understand their options. This requires a shift in focus from merely recommending products to facilitating a dialogue that encourages clients to explore their needs, goals, and fears. Effective advisers ask probing questions that challenge clients&#8217; assumptions and encourage them to think critically about their financial choices. By doing so, they help clients recognize the trade-offs involved in their decisions, fostering a sense of ownership and responsibility.<\/p>\n<p>Moreover, the emotional aspect of financial decision-making cannot be overlooked. Money is often tied to deep-seated fears and aspirations. A skilled adviser provides perspective when emotions threaten to cloud judgment, guiding clients through the decision-making process with compassion and clarity. This supportive role is crucial, as it helps clients commit to long-term plans even when the market is volatile or when personal circumstances change.<\/p>\n<p>Key takeaways from this educational approach to financial advising include:<\/p>\n<p>1. **Education as Empowerment**: Understanding financial options empowers clients to make informed decisions.
